businesses
94 Station Lane
Hornchurch
Essex
RM12 6LX
Report a problem with this listing
The Devonshire Hotel offers stylish accommodation, friendly service, delicious breakfast and freshly prepared home-made snacks. Free Wifi Internet access and secure parking.